At a Glance

Mineral Group Phosphate
Chemical Formula Ca₅(PO₄)₃(F,Cl,OH)
Crystal System Hexagonal
Mohs Hardness 5
Typical Colours Blue • Green • Teal • Yellow • Golden • Purple • Pink • Brown • Colourless
Transparency Transparent to Opaque
Lustre Vitreous (Glassy)
Common Sources Brazil • Madagascar • Mexico • Myanmar • Russia • Canada • Norway • Morocco • Sri Lanka • Pakistan
Rarity Common as a mineral, fine gem-quality crystals are uncommon
Suitable for Jewellery Yes, with care
Water Safe Yes, for gentle cleaning
Sunlight Stable under normal display conditions, though prolonged intense sunlight may fade some colours
Toxicity Safe to handle. Do not ingest.
Common Treatments Usually untreated; some gemstones may be heated or clarity enhanced

The Story Written by the Earth

Apatite is the name given to a group of closely related phosphate minerals that occur throughout the Earth's crust.

Although collectors often think of Apatite as a colourful gemstone, geologists recognise it as one of the planet's most important rock-forming minerals. It occurs in igneous, metamorphic and sedimentary rocks, making it one of the few minerals found across virtually every major geological environment.

Chemically, Apatite is a calcium phosphate mineral, most commonly represented by the formula:

Ca₅(PO₄)₃(F,Cl,OH)

The final part of this formula reveals something fascinating.

Fluorine, chlorine and hydroxyl groups can substitute for one another within the crystal structure, producing three principal members of the Apatite family:

• Fluorapatite

• Chlorapatite

• Hydroxylapatite

These substitutions create subtle differences in chemistry while maintaining the same beautiful hexagonal crystal structure.

Among them, Fluorapatite is by far the most abundant and is the variety most commonly encountered by collectors.

Apatite crystallises within the hexagonal crystal system, typically forming elegant six-sided prismatic crystals with beautifully developed crystal faces. Well-formed crystals often possess sharp geometric symmetry that makes them highly attractive as collector specimens.

Unlike many gemstones that form under a narrow range of geological conditions, Apatite is remarkably adaptable.

It develops in slowly cooling igneous rocks such as granite and pegmatite, within metamorphic rocks altered by heat and pressure, and even in marine sedimentary deposits created over hundreds of millions of years.

This extraordinary versatility helps explain why Apatite is found on every continent.

Its colours are equally fascinating.

Pure Apatite is generally colourless.

The dazzling blues, greens, yellows, violets and pinks admired by collectors are produced by trace amounts of elements such as manganese, iron and rare earth elements becoming incorporated into the crystal structure as it grows.

Even tiny variations in these trace elements can create dramatically different colours.

Some of the world's most spectacular Apatite comes from Madagascar, where vivid neon-blue crystals have become especially prized. Brazil produces beautifully transparent blue and green material, while Mexico, Myanmar, Pakistan and Russia are also renowned for exceptional specimens.

Canada and Norway have long been important sources for collectors, producing large crystals that have contributed significantly to mineralogical research.

Although Apatite has a respectable hardness of 5 on the Mohs scale, it is considerably softer than many gemstones commonly used in jewellery.

This means that while it can produce stunning faceted stones with exceptional brilliance, it requires more thoughtful care than harder gemstones such as Sapphire or Aquamarine.

For this reason, Apatite is particularly popular in earrings, pendants and collector jewellery where it is less likely to experience everyday wear.

One of the most remarkable aspects of Apatite lies beyond its beauty.

It is the Earth's principal source of phosphorus.

Phosphorus is an essential element for agriculture, forming the basis of many fertilisers that help feed billions of people around the world. Without phosphate minerals such as Apatite, modern food production would be dramatically different.

Even more extraordinary, the mineral Hydroxylapatite forms the primary mineral component of human bones and teeth.

Although biological apatite differs slightly from the geological crystals collected by mineral enthusiasts, they belong to the same remarkable mineral family.

Very few minerals create such an intimate connection between geology and biology.

Apatite reminds us that the Earth is not separate from life.

It helped build it.


Nature's Signature

No two pieces of Apatite ever tell exactly the same story.

Some display brilliant tropical blues that seem almost electric in their intensity, while others reveal deep forest greens, soft sea-green tones, golden honey colours or delicate shades of violet and pink.

Even within a single crystal, colour zoning is common.

Bands of lighter and darker colour may develop as the chemistry of the mineral-rich fluids changed during crystal growth, creating beautiful natural patterns that record the crystal's formation over millions of years.

Transparency varies enormously.

Some Apatite crystals are remarkably clear, allowing light to travel freely through the stone and producing exceptional brilliance when faceted. Others contain graceful veils, tiny liquid inclusions or delicate fractures that provide fascinating evidence of their geological history.

Natural crystal shape also varies.

Many specimens develop beautifully formed hexagonal prisms with flat terminations, while others grow as massive aggregates, rounded nodules or embedded crystals within their surrounding rock matrix.

Collectors often appreciate these differences just as much as colour itself.

They are not imperfections.

They are the mineral's fingerprint.

Each variation reflects a unique combination of chemistry, temperature, pressure and time that can never be perfectly repeated.

Every specimen of Apatite is therefore a one-of-a-kind record of the remarkable geological conditions that created it.

Through Human Eyes

Few minerals have a name as intriguing as Apatite.

It comes from the Greek word apataō, meaning "to deceive" or "to mislead." The name was chosen in 1786 by the German geologist Abraham Gottlob Werner because Apatite was so frequently mistaken for other minerals.

Its remarkable range of colours often caused it to be confused with Emerald, Peridot, Aquamarine, Topaz, Tourmaline and even Beryl. Before modern mineralogy developed, many specimens were incorrectly identified simply because they looked so similar to other well-known gemstones.

In this case, the mineral wasn't deceptive by intention.

It was simply wonderfully versatile.

As scientific understanding improved, mineralogists realised that these colourful crystals all belonged to an entirely different mineral family, one whose importance extended far beyond jewellery and collecting.

Unlike many gemstones that have been prized primarily for adornment, Apatite has played a vital role in helping scientists understand the Earth itself.

Because it incorporates tiny amounts of uranium while rejecting lead during crystal formation, Apatite has become an important mineral for geological dating. By studying these trace elements, researchers can determine the age of rocks, reconstruct ancient mountain-building events and even investigate the movement of fluids through the Earth's crust over immense spans of time.

In this way, Apatite acts almost like a geological archive.

Its crystals quietly preserve information about the environments in which they formed, allowing scientists to read stories written hundreds of millions of years ago.

Outside the laboratory, Apatite continues to captivate collectors and jewellers alike.

Fine gem-quality material is admired for its extraordinary brilliance and vivid colours, while natural crystal specimens are treasured for their elegant hexagonal forms and remarkable diversity.

Although softer than many popular gemstones, carefully protected Apatite jewellery displays a freshness and vibrancy that few other stones can match.

Today, Apatite is appreciated from many different perspectives.

Geologists value the information it preserves.

Collectors admire its remarkable colours.

Jewellers celebrate its brilliance.

Scientists recognise its importance to agriculture and biology.

And countless people simply enjoy discovering a mineral that quietly connects so many different parts of the natural world.

Rarity & Collectability

Apatite is an interesting paradox.

As a mineral, it is one of the most abundant phosphate minerals on Earth.

As a fine gemstone, it is considerably less common.

Large, transparent crystals displaying vivid colour without significant inclusions are relatively uncommon, and exceptional gem-quality material commands strong interest among collectors.

The most desirable specimens often display:

• Strong, vivid colour

• Excellent transparency

• Well-developed crystal form

• Bright vitreous lustre

• Minimal fractures

• Large crystal size

• Documented locality

Among collectors, neon-blue material from Madagascar has achieved almost legendary status because of its extraordinary saturation and brilliance. Deep green Brazilian Apatite and beautifully formed crystals from Pakistan, Mexico and Myanmar are also highly regarded.

Because Apatite is softer than many gemstones, exceptionally clean faceted stones in larger sizes are less common than might first be expected. Larger gems require careful cutting and handling to preserve their beauty.

Like many natural treasures, rarity is not simply about abundance.

It is about how rarely nature creates specimens that combine outstanding colour, clarity, crystal form and size into one extraordinary mineral.

Caring for Apatite

Although Apatite possesses exceptional beauty, it is a gemstone that benefits from thoughtful care.

With a Mohs hardness of approximately 5, it is softer than Quartz and considerably softer than many gemstones commonly worn every day. This means it can scratch or chip more easily if subjected to rough handling.

To care for your Apatite:

• Clean gently using lukewarm water, mild soap and a soft cloth.

• Avoid abrasive cleaners or harsh chemicals.

• Dry carefully after cleaning.

• Store separately from harder minerals and gemstones to prevent scratching.

• Remove Apatite jewellery before gardening, sport, heavy lifting or household tasks.

• Avoid ultrasonic and steam cleaners unless advised by a professional gemmologist.

Natural crystal specimens should also be handled with care, particularly if they contain delicate crystal terminations or fine matrix.

With sensible care, Apatite will continue to display its remarkable colours and beauty for many years.


Safety & Handling

Apatite is considered safe for normal handling, display and jewellery use.

Like all minerals, it should never be ingested and should be kept away from very young children who may place small objects in their mouths.

Although the mineral contains phosphorus as part of its chemical structure, this element is chemically bound within the crystal and presents no risk during normal handling.

Because Apatite is relatively soft, avoid dropping specimens onto hard surfaces where crystals may chip or fracture.

Thoughtful handling is all that is required to enjoy this remarkable mineral safely.

Frequently Asked Questions

Is Apatite a real gemstone?

Yes. Although not as widely known as Sapphire or Emerald, Apatite is a genuine gemstone and is highly valued for its exceptional colours and brilliance.

Why is Apatite so colourful?

Its colours are produced by tiny amounts of trace elements such as manganese, iron and rare earth elements becoming incorporated into the crystal as it forms.

Is Apatite suitable for everyday jewellery?

Apatite can certainly be worn as jewellery, but because it has a Mohs hardness of about 5, it is better suited to earrings, pendants and occasional wear rather than rings worn every day.

Why is it called Apatite?

The name comes from the Greek word apataō, meaning "to deceive," because Apatite was historically mistaken for many other colourful gemstones.

Can Apatite go in water?

Yes. Gentle cleaning with clean water and mild soap is perfectly suitable. Avoid harsh chemicals and prolonged exposure to abrasive conditions.

Is every Apatite blue?

No. Although blue Apatite is the best known, the mineral naturally occurs in green, yellow, violet, pink, brown and colourless varieties as well.

Is Apatite rare?

Apatite is common as a mineral but fine gem-quality material displaying vivid colour and excellent transparency is considerably less common and highly sought after.
